How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Córdoba by plane is to fly into Seville Airport (SVQ) or Madrid-Barajas Airport (MAD) and then take a bus or train to Córdoba.

Car

Driving to Córdoba is easy as the city is well connected by road. You can take the A-4 (Autovía del Sur) from Madrid or Seville, or the A-45 from Málaga.

Train

You can take the AVE train from Madrid to Córdoba. The train leaves from Madrid Atocha Station and arrives at Cordoba Central Station.

Boat

There are no boats that go directly to Córdoba as it is an inland city. The nearest ports are in Malaga and Algeciras, which are both located along the southern coast of Spain.

Bus

The best way to get to Córdoba by bus is to take a bus from Seville Bus Station (Estación de Autobuses de Sevilla). There are several bus companies that operate this route, including ALSA and Socibus.
